πŸ˜‚ 50 Funny Jokes for Kids

kids jokes with parentes

Why did the math book look sad?
πŸ‘‰ Because it had too many problems!

Why don’t eggs tell jokes?
πŸ‘‰ Because they might crack up!

What did one wall say to the other wall?
πŸ‘‰ I’ll meet you at the corner!

Why did the bicycle fall over?
πŸ‘‰ Because it was two-tired!

What did the zero say to the eight?
πŸ‘‰ Nice belt!

Why did the computer go to school?
πŸ‘‰ To learn how to use its mouse!

Why was the broom late?
πŸ‘‰ It swept in!

What did one plate say to the other plate?
πŸ‘‰ Dinner is on me!

Why did the picture go to jail?
πŸ‘‰ Because it was framed!

Why did the cookie go to the doctor?
πŸ‘‰ Because it felt crummy!

What do you call cheese that isn’t yours?
πŸ‘‰ Nacho cheese!

Why did the banana go to the doctor?
πŸ‘‰ Because it wasn’t peeling well!

Why did the scarecrow win an award?
πŸ‘‰ Because he was outstanding in his field!

What did the big flower say to the little flower?
πŸ‘‰ Hey bud!

Why did the kid bring a ladder?
πŸ‘‰ Because he wanted to go to high school!

What do you call a fake noodle?
πŸ‘‰ An impasta!

Why did the teddy bear say no to dessert?
πŸ‘‰ Because it was already stuffed!

What did one hat say to the other?
πŸ‘‰ You stay here, I’ll go on ahead!

Why did the kid bring a spoon?
πŸ‘‰ Because the lesson was souper!

Why did the clock go to school?
πŸ‘‰ To learn how to tell time!

Why did the pencil break up?
πŸ‘‰ It felt pointless!

Why did the kid sit on his watch?
πŸ‘‰ He wanted to be on time!

What did the paper say to the pencil?
πŸ‘‰ Write on!

Why was the book cold?
πŸ‘‰ Because it left its cover open!

Why did the kid smile at the broom?
πŸ‘‰ It was sweeping!

What do you call a funny mountain?
πŸ‘‰ Hill-arious!

Why did the chair get promoted?
πŸ‘‰ It always stood up!
